The US aviation industry and other tourism-related enterprises are urging the White House to draft a plan in the next five weeks to lift the restrictions on world travel at the beginning of the COVID-19 outbreak, so as to restore the normal life of people around the world.

On Monday, more than 24 companies and organizations jointly submitted their demands to the White House. The company hopes that people who have been vaccinated with COVID-19 vaccine can be exempted from testing requirements before entering the United States. They also want the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ention to say that people who are vaccinated can travel safely.

These organizations say that these and other measures will accelerate the recovery of tourism and aviation. During the epidemic, the tourism industry was severely hit.

Air travel in the United States has begun to increase. In the past 1 1 day, more than 1 10,000 people passed through the security checkpoints of American airports every day, and the total number of people who received security checks on Sunday exceeded 1.5 million for the first time in more than a year. However, the passenger flow is still below.

Organizations calling for the relaxation of international restrictions include American Airlines (AAL). US), the largest airline in the United States, the American Tourist Association and the American Chamber of Commerce. They hope that the US government will lift the one-year international travel restrictions before May 1.

Normalization of personnel exchanges has entered the agenda of China and the United States.

Last week, the talks between China and the United States in Anchorage, Alaska attracted global attention.

According to official media reports, the talks between China and the United States touched on the issue of personnel exchanges between China and the United States.

Xinhua News Agency reported that the original text is as follows: The two sides expressed their views on adjusting relevant tourism and visa policies according to the epidemic situation and gradually promoting the normalization of personnel exchanges between China and the United States.

At the same time, it was pointed out that the two sides discussed the issue of peer-to-peer organizations vaccinating their diplomatic and consular personnel against COVID-19.

This shows that visa and sightseeing between China and the United States have now been put on the agenda.
